starting problem :( PLEASE HELP

I am having problems starting my CRX. It has a b-16a in it. It is really sparatic, it only does in in the summer, and only when it is really hot(this may just be coincidence, but the fact that it did it last summer, then not at all this winter makes me wonder). I thought it was the distributor cap/rotor/seal. I've replaced the cap, with a 91 Integra RS cap(i was told to replace with a 94 del sol, or 92-93 GSR, but these did not fit. Only the Teg RS fit). I have the rotor on order, but because it had just started up this morning, i would have thought just fixing the cap, and the seal(not the actual seal, just used an O-ring, parts store did not have an actual seal with the cap, guess i'll have to go to the dealer) would have fixed it, but it did not.

So, my question to you guys is: What else besides the distrubitor cap/rotor/seal would be the problem?? What else would be heat related. I really am lost as is my dad and uncle(pretty good with cars). HELP ME! I need to get to work, lol,(and play!!)

yep main relay is heat related, in hot days or after a while of runing the car te main relay heats up and doesnt send signal to the fuel ingectors fuel sistem etc. the relay is under the dash in the drivers area under the tach. its a black box the size of a beeper, has 12v stamped in white. change it, it costs around $60 $80 at honda u can get it used for like $20 but wont last as long as the new one. now im 99.99.9% sure its the relay.

Yep its the main relay, I have a 90 Integra and I had the same problem. It wouldn't start when the car was hot or warm from driving. I changed my starter and distribitor before finding that out.
